Other Information; Cookies

We use cookies, web beacons, and similar technologies to operate our services efficiently and as intended. A cookie is a small file containing a string of characters that is sent to your computer when you visit a website. When you visit the website again, the cookie allows that site to recognize your browser. Cookies may store unique identifiers, user preferences and other information. Through such technologies, we gather information about you, such as your browser type, operating system, IP address, mobile device identification number, the sites visited before and after our Site, and about your interactions with our services, such as the time and date when you viewed a page, location of visit, browsing actions, and whether you filled out an online form. Web beacons are small electronic files (also known as clear gifs, pixel tags, or single-pixel gifs) to permit Agile to count users who have visited pages or interacted with marketing communications.

You may set your browser to block all cookies, including Agile and its subsidiaries while using our services, but doing so will prevent some aspects of our services to not function properly. You may also set your browser to block third-party cookies and allow first-party cookies, which would allow us (but not third parties) to collect such information while you are on our sites. In addition, some browsers may allow you to block certain web beacons and similar tracking codes. Please refer to your browser’s documentation if you wish to block some or all cookies, web beacons, and/or similar tools. Do Not Track

The Service does not support Do Not Track at this time. Do Not Track is a privacy preference that you can set in your web browser to indicate that you do not want certain information about your webpage visits collected across websites when you have not interacted with that service on the page.
